Trough-shaped dolmen Kokai-3 (detailed)
The dolmen is located under Kokai cliffs (Kokai group of monuments), Mezetsu range, Tuapse region, Caucasus, Russia, Middle Bronze Age (4000-2000 BC), Dolmen Culture of Caucasus. Sepulcher chamber is carved out of large block of stone. Trapezoidal in shape chamber is sealed with a flat capstone. This construction imitate plan and elements of the plinth type of stone slabs. The distinctive element of this version is its access hole placed on side wall. So, the largest wall of that construction is the side of false portal. Another unique element is protruding shelf on rare side of this chamber. The third strange element is the box-shaped roof inside camera. Ishtar Gate of Babylon [detail, Mušḫuššu]
Pergamon Museum Berlin, 2017 "The Ishtar Gate (Arabic: بوابة عشتار, Persian: دروازه ایشتار) was the eighth gate to the inner city of Babylon. It was constructed in about 575 BCE by order of King Nebuchadnezzar II on the north side of the city. It was excavated in the early 20th century and a reconstruction using original bricks is now shown in the Pergamon Museum, Berlin." ~ https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ishtar_Gate "The mušḫuššu (𒈲𒄭𒄊; formerly also read as sirrušu, sirrush) is a creature depicted on the reconstructed Ishtar Gate of the city of Babylon, dating to the 6th century B.C. As depicted, it is a mythological hybrid: a scaly dragon with hind legs resembling the talons of an eagle, feline forelegs, a long neck and tail, a horned head, a snake-like tongue, and a crest." ~ https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mu%C5%A1%E1%B8%ABu%C5%A1%C5%A1u 26 photos, Canon G7X, RealityCapture Source: Objaverse 1.0 / Sketchfab

Ornamental cabinet [detail], Rijksmuseum
"Ornamental cabinet with biblical motifs, Anonymous, c. 1630 - c. 1650 wood, h 212.5cm × w 159.0cm × d 78.5cm. More details An ornamental cabinet with four doors was the showpiece of an interior. The three figures on the upper section represent the principal Christian virtues of Faith, Hope and Charity. The two doors of the upper section are decorated with scenes from the Old Testament story of Susanna, who resisted the advances of two elderly men." - https://www.rijksmuseum.nl/en/search/objecten?q=furniture&f=1&p=3&ps=12&type=furniture&material=wood&ondisplay=True&ii=0#/BK-NM-11448,24 Source: Objaverse 1.0 / Sketchfab

Detail of the coat of arms on folio 230r of the Anjou Bible
<p>Detail of the coat of arms on folio 230r of the Bible of Anjou (MS1, Maurits Sabbe Library, KU Leuven Libraries). (<strong>A-E</strong>) showing the automatic created (false) color images in the viewer application: (<strong>A</strong>): R-G-B. (<strong>B</strong>) IR-R-G, (<strong>C</strong>) IR-G-B, (<strong>D</strong>) R-G-UV, (<strong>E</strong>) G-B-UV. For the on (<strong>A</strong>) blue fields, the false color images (<strong>B</strong>) and (<strong>C</strong>) have the same spectral response as the ultra-marine zones on folio 003V; the same goes for the MS histogram of these zones (<strong>F</strong>) shows the pure IR data, hinting at the overpainted original coat of arms. (© RICH Project & KU Leuven)</p>

Allen Brain Atlas
Allen Brain Atlas is an Allen Institute collection of brain map atlases, datasets, APIs, and analysis tools covering mouse, human, and non-human primate brain resources.
Annotated Behaviour and Observability Dataset (ABODe)
ABODe is a University of Edinburgh DataShare dataset for behavior classification in group-housed mice using home-cage video, identities, bounding boxes, ground-plate positions, and annotator labels.
DANDI Archive for NWB datasets
D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.
International Brain Laboratory public data
The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
OpenNeuro
OpenNeuro is a free, open platform for sharing neuroimaging datasets, with public search, dataset pages, and download paths for web, S3, DataLad, and the OpenNeuro CLI.
